To answer the question "Moderate increase in the requirement of trace elements induces:", we can break down the concepts involved in mineral nutrition, particularly focusing on trace elements. ### Step-by-Step Solution: 1. **Understanding Trace Elements**: Trace elements (or microelements) are essential nutrients required by plants in very small amounts. Examples include iron, manganese, zinc, copper, molybdenum, and boron. 2. **Deficiency of Trace Elements**: When there is a deficiency of these trace elements, it can lead to various metabolic disorders in plants. These disorders can affect growth, development, and overall health. 3. **Excess of Trace Elements**: Conversely, if there is an increase in the requirement or availability of these trace elements, it can lead to toxicity. This means that while the plants need these elements, too much of them can be harmful. 4. **Moderate Increase**: The question specifies a "moderate increase" in the requirement of trace elements. This suggests that while the increase is not extreme, it is still significant enough to potentially lead to negative effects. 5. **Conclusion**: Therefore, a moderate increase in the requirement of trace elements induces toxicity in plants. This toxicity can manifest in various ways, such as impaired growth, chlorosis, or other physiological disturbances. 6. **Final Answer**: The correct answer is that a moderate increase in the requirement of trace elements induces toxicity.
